Hoshikawa Ginza Yonchoume · review
Art: 4 The manga creator was going for a slightly different character design and it's okay but in some of the cells the drawings of the characters look rushed. It's also pretty obvious the creator can't draw backgrounds, as most of the backgrounds are minimal or are drawn poorly. Story: 3 I don't want to spoil it in case one would still want to read it after reading this, so I'll give a general feel for the story. The story itself is questionable even for a manga and there are so many holes in it that I couldn't continue. Its implausible but the story requires that youthink it's plausible, so you're left in a weird position as the reader.
Character: 4
The characters were pretty straight forward and don't offer anything new or special. So the character of the manga itself falls flat, it's suppose to be a romantic drama comedy from what I can tell but all of those fields aren't done very well.
Enjoyment/ Conclusion: 4
I couldn't really enjoy it because of the plot holes, weak characters, and weak art.
Overall: 3.75
